Consultez la FAQ sur le ZF avant de poster une question
Vous n'êtes pas identifié.
Bonjour,
je n'arrive pas à écrire cet requête:
SELECT t.id, c.from, c.to
FROM travels AS t
LEFT JOIN cities AS c ON t.from_id=c.id
LEFT JOIN cities AS c ON t.to_id=c.id
Hors ligne
Bonjour,
Quelque chose comme cela devrait fonctionner :
[lang=php] $select = $travelsTableAdaptater->getSql()->select() ->join('cities', ' travels.from_id=cities.id', array('cities.from','cities.to')) ->join('cities ', 'travels.to_id=cities.id', array()); $result = $travelsTableAdaptater->selectWith($select);
Hors ligne